Tulsa's running life is anchored by the Arkansas River. On any given morning you'll find people moving along the River Parks paths from 11th Street south, some sticking to the smooth asphalt, others peeling off toward the dirt singletrack of Turkey Mountain Urban Wilderness on the west bank. The two worlds - flat riverfront pavement and rugged trail mileage - sit minutes apart inside the same metro.

Fall is when Tulsa runners feel it most: the humidity finally breaks, the city's race calendar stacks up, and downtown streets fill with crowds the way they do nowhere else in the year. If you're training for a half marathon, you're already in the right place and the right season.

Common Questions About Running a Half Marathon in Tulsa

What's a typical finishing time for a Tulsa half marathon?

Across the 4 RunSignup half marathon editions with published results on RunSesh, walkers and charity entrants included, the median finisher crossed in 2:18:54. The median winner finished in 1:28:01, and the last finisher typically came in around 3:56:48. Fields have ranged from 334 to 371 runners in the editions that publish that figure, so you won't be alone out there at any pace.

When is the best time of year to find a half marathon in Tulsa?

Fall, running September through November, is the busiest stretch on the calendar, with 6 of the 12 races packed into those months. October alone holds 3. If fall doesn't fit your training block, there are also options in winter and spring, though the calendar is thinner in those seasons.

What will it cost me to enter, and does the price go up if I wait?

Entry fees currently run from $22 to $45. The most common price point is $25. Five of the 12 races already have a price increase scheduled, so registering early is the straightforward way to lock in the lower fee.

Will I get a shirt for running a Tulsa half marathon?

8 of the 12 races say they give a shirt. The other 4 haven't published giveaway details, which means we don't know - not that they give nothing. If a race shirt matters to you, check the individual race page or reach out to the organizer directly before signing up.
